DNS-välimuistin tyhjennys

DNS:n tyhjennyksen määritelmä ja prosessi

DNS:n tyhjennys, joka tunnetaan myös nimellä DNS-välimuistin tyhjennys, on prosessi, jossa tyhjennetään tai nollataan tietokoneen tai verkon laitteen Domain Name System (DNS) -välimuisti. DNS-välimuistissa säilytetään tallenteita äskettäin käytettyjen verkkosivustojen verkkotunnuksista ja niiden vastaavista IP-osoitteista. Tyhjentämällä DNS-välimuistin voit poistaa vanhentuneet tai virheelliset DNS-tallenteet, mikä voi parantaa verkon suorituskykyä ja ratkaista yhteysongelmia.

Kun laite käyttää verkkosivustoa, DNS-resolveri tallentaa verkkosivuston verkkotunnuksen ja sen vastaavan IP-osoitteen paikalliseen DNS-välimuistiin. Tämä mahdollistaa sen, että laite voi nopeasti löytää verkkosivuston ilman, että se kysyy toistuvasti ulkoisia DNS-palvelimia. Jos kuitenkin verkkosivustoon liittyvä IP-osoite muuttuu tai jos on DNS-resoluution ongelmia, välimuistissa olevat tallenteet saattavat vanhentua tai olla epätarkkoja, mikä johtaa yhteysongelmiin.

DNS:n tyhjennys tarkoittaa kaikkien välimuistiin tallennettujen DNS-tallenteiden poistamista paikallisesta DNS-resolverista. Tällä tavoin laite on pakotettu suorittamaan uudet DNS-haut kaikille käyttämilleen verkkosivustoille varmistaakseen, että se saa ajantasaisimmat tiedot ulkoisilta DNS-palvelimilta. Tämä voi olla erityisen hyödyllistä verkon yhteysongelmien ratkaisemisessa, kun ne liittyvät DNS-resoluutioon.

Kuinka suorittaa DNS:n tyhjennys

DNS:n tyhjennyksen suorittaminen vaihtelee käyttämäsi käyttöjärjestelmän mukaan. Tässä ovat ohjeet DNS-välimuistin tyhjentämiseen suosituissa käyttöjärjestelmissä:

Windows

  1. Avaa Komentokehote järjestelmänvalvojana. Tämä onnistuu etsimällä "Komentokehote" Käynnistä-valikosta, napsauttamalla sitä hiiren oikealla painikkeella ja valitsemalla "Suorita järjestelmänvalvojana".
  2. Kirjoita Komentokehote-ikkunaan seuraava komento ja paina Enter: ipconfig /flushdns
  3. Odota, että prosessi suoritetaan loppuun. Kun se on valmis, näet viestin "DNS Resolver Cache tyhjennetty onnistuneesti".

macOS

  1. Avaa Terminal-sovellus. Löydät sen Utilities-kansiosta, joka sijaitsee Applications-kansiossa.
  2. Kirjoita Terminal-ikkunaan seuraava komento ja paina Enter: sudo killall -HUP mDNSResponder
  3. Sinua pyydetään syöttämään järjestelmänvalvojan salasanasi. Kirjoita se ja paina Enter. Huomaa, että salasana pysyy näkymättömänä kirjoittaessasi.
  4. Odota, että prosessi suoritetaan loppuun. Kun se on valmis, et näe vahvistusviestiä.

Linux

  1. Avaa terminaalisovellus Linux-jakelussasi. Tämä onnistuu yleensä etsimällä "Terminal" sovellusvalikosta tai käyttämällä pikanäppäintä Ctrl+Alt+T.
  2. Kirjoita terminaali-ikkunaan seuraava komento ja paina Enter: sudo systemd-resolve --flush-caches
  3. Sinua pyydetään syöttämään salasanasi. Kirjoita se ja paina Enter. Huomaa, että salasana pysyy näkymättömänä kirjoittaessasi.
  4. Odota, että prosessi suoritetaan loppuun. Kun se on valmis, et näe vahvistusviestiä.

Miksi DNS:n tyhjennys on tärkeää

On useita syitä, miksi DNS:n tyhjennys on tärkeä toimenpide, kun ratkaistaan verkon yhteysongelmia ja ylläpidetään terveellistä verkkoyhteyttä:

  1. DNS:ään liittyvien ongelmien ratkaiseminen: DNS-välimuistin tyhjennys voi auttaa ratkaisemaan erilaisia DNS:ään liittyviä ongelmia, jotka voivat aiheuttaa verkon yhteysongelmia. Tyhjentämällä välimuistin varmistat, että laitteesi saa ajantasaisimmat DNS-tiedot ulkoisilta DNS-palvelimilta.

  2. IP-osoitteen muutos: Kun verkkosivusto vaihtaa IP-osoitettaan, vanha IP-osoite voi yhä olla välimuistissa laitteesi paikallisessa DNS-resolverissa. Tämä voi johtaa yhteysongelmiin, kun laitteesi yrittää yhdistää vanhentuneeseen IP-osoitteeseen. DNS-välimuistin tyhjennys varmistaa, että laitteesi käyttää oikeaa, päivitettyä IP-osoitetta verkkosivustolle.

  3. Vanhentuneiden tai virheellisten tallenteiden poistaminen: Joskus DNS-välimuistin tallenteet voivat vanhentua tai olla virheellisiä, mikä johtaa ongelmiin verkkosivustojen käyttöönotossa. DNS-välimuistin tyhjennys poistaa nämä vanhentuneet tallenteet ja pakottaa laitteesi suorittamaan uudet DNS-haut kaikille käyttämilleen verkkosivustoille.

  4. Verkon suorituskyvyn parantaminen: Tyhjentämällä DNS-välimuistin poistat tarpeettomia tallenteita ja vapautat muistia, mikä voi auttaa parantamaan verkon suorituskykyä. Tämä pätee erityisesti, jos välimuistissa on suuri määrä vanhentuneita tai virheellisiä tallenteita.

Liittyvät termit

Tässä on joitakin liittyviä termejä, joita saatat kohdata oppiessasi DNS:stä ja verkkoyhteyksistä:

  • DNS Hijacking: DNS-kaappaus on eräänlainen kyberhyökkäys, jossa hyökkääjä ohjaa DNS-kyselyjä väärälle palvelimelle. Tämä voi mahdollisesti johtaa liikenteen sieppaamiseen tai manipulointiin, mikä vaarantaa käyttäjien turvallisuuden ja yksityisyyden.

  • DNS Spoofing: DNS-huijaus on pahansuopa käytäntö, jossa DNS-resoluutiota manipuloidaan ohjaamaan käyttäjiä väärennetyille tai haitallisille verkkosivustoille. Manipuloimalla DNS-vastauksia hyökkääjät voivat huijata käyttäjiä vierailemaan väärennetyillä verkkosivustoilla ja mahdollisesti varastaa heidän arkaluonteisia tietojaan.

  • DNS Security Extensions (DNSSEC): DNS Security Extensions (DNSSEC) on joukko laajennuksia, jotka on suunniteltu lisäämään turvallisuutta DNS-protokollaan. DNSSEC auttaa suojaamaan erilaisilta hyökkäyksiltä, mukaan lukien DNS-välimuistin myrkytys ja välistävetohyökkäykset. Allekirjoittamalla DNS-tallenteet digitaalisesti DNSSEC varmistaa DNS-tietojen aitouden ja koskemattomuuden.

Tutustumalla näihin liittyviin termeihin voit saada paremman käsityksen laajemmista käsitteistä ja haasteista, jotka liittyvät DNS:ään ja verkkoturvallisuuteen.

Yhteenvetona voidaan todeta, että DNS-välimuistin tyhjennys on tärkeä askel verkon yhteysongelmien ratkaisemisessa ja terveellisen verkkoyhteyden ylläpitämisessä. Tyhjentämällä DNS-välimuistin varmistat, että laitteesi saa ajantasaisimmat DNS-tiedot, ratkaisee DNS:ään liittyvät ongelmat, päivittää IP-osoitteen muutokset ja parantaa verkon suorituskykyä. Lisäksi DNS-kaappauksen, DNS-huijauksen ja DNSSEC:n kaltaisten liittyvien termien tunteminen voi auttaa sinua ymmärtämään laajemman DNS:n ja verkkoturvallisuuden kontekstin.

Get VPN Unlimited now!